A Day in Bhubaneswar: Exploring the City's Best Sights

  1. 9:00AM: Lingaraj Temple
    15 minutes (3.6 km) from Bhubaneswar Railway Station

    Begin your day by visiting the famous Lingaraj Temple, a remarkable Hindu shrine that dates back to the 11th century. Admire the exquisite architecture, intricate carvings, and the serene ambience of the temple.

  2. 11:00AM: Ekamra Kanan Botanical Gardens
    10 minutes (2.7 km) from Lingaraj Temple

    Relax and rejuvenate amidst the lush greenery of Ekamra Kanan Botanical Gardens. Spread across 512 acres, the garden is home to a variety of flora and fauna, making it a perfect place to unwind and connect with nature.

  3. 1:00PM: Odisha State Museum
    15 minutes (3.9 km) from Ekamra Kanan Botanical Gardens

    Explore the rich cultural heritage of Odisha at the State Museum. The museum houses an impressive collection of ancient stone sculptures, coins, paintings, and other artifacts that reflect the state's fascinating history and traditions.

  4. 3:00PM: Khandagiri and Udayagiri Caves
    20 minutes (6.7 km) from Odisha State Museum

    Discover the ancient Jain rock-cut caves of Khandagiri and Udayagiri, which date back to the 2nd century BC. Marvel at the intricate carvings, inscriptions, and stunning views of the city from the top of the caves.

  5. 5:00PM: Mukteswara Temple
    20 minutes (5.2 km) from Khandagiri and Udayagiri Caves

    End your day by visiting the magnificent Mukteswara Temple, an architectural marvel that is dedicated to Lord Shiva. The temple is famous for its exquisite carvings and sculptures, which showcase the intricate craftsmanship of the artists who built it.

Recommendations

If you have time, consider visiting the Nandankanan Zoological Park or the Dhauli Peace Pagoda, which are popular tourist spots in Bhubaneswar. You can also take a day trip to Puri, a beautiful seaside town located about an hour's drive from Bhubaneswar. To maximize your fun, try the local street food, which includes delicacies like chaat, samosas, and jalebis. Don't forget to shop for traditional handicrafts and souvenirs at some of the city's bustling markets.
